Design the new Library bag!

bag for kathrynNow is finally your chance to design the Library Bag that will be on sale for students and staff to buy. Here are the specifications:

This competition is only open to current Goldsmiths Students.

– The prize for this competition is a £50 Amazon voucher and having your design printed onto bags to sell in the Library.

– The designs will be judged by design professionals Juliet Sprake, Rose Sinclair, and the Library marketing team.

– The bag must say, or represent, the Library in some way.

– The design can be no bigger than 35cm (Width) and 38cm (Height).

– The design must include the Library URL. www.gold.ac.uk/library

– The background colour of the bag will be cream.

– Designs should be initially sent as a JPEG (no bigger than 20MB) to librarywebteam@gold.ac.uk, we will then need the winner to provide the original design for printing as either PSD/EPS/AI/TIFF format, with resolution of at least 300-400 pixels (dpi).  If you prefer to work by hand, original art should be scanned at 1200 dpi and submitted as an EPS file.

– Art must be 100 percent of the size to be reproduced, i.e. to fit in an area 38 cm high by 35 cm wide.

– The design can only be in one colour, but you can choose the colour. The colour you choose must be available in the Pantone uncoated library (U numbers on the pantone chart), an approximation of these can be found in the Photoshop/InDesign colour library, or you can look them up on an online pantone colour chart.

– Please ensure that all fonts are converted to outlines to eliminate the likelihood that the printers do not have the fonts used in your artwork, or embed them in the file.

– You must leave space in the bottom right hand corner of the bag for the Goldsmiths Logo.

– We reserve the right to edit the design in consultation with the winning entrant.

– The winning entrant will need to pass the copyright of the image onto the Library.

– All entered designs may be used for publicity after or during the competition, e.g. a display of the entries.

– All entries must be received by midnight of the 3rd of April, entries received after this time will not be counted.
